Description
The Controller oversees the accurate closing of the company financials and reports to the CFO in the reforecast process. This person will oversee the AP Manager, AR Manager (payment processing) and the Assistant Controller.
On-site in Austin, TX
Monday - Friday, 8am - 5pm
Job Duties:
Collaborate with the Assistant Controller to close the company financials and prepare the monthly financial package, which includes a balance sheet, income statement, and statement of cash flows.
Lead and manage the AP Manager, AR Manager, and Assistant Controller.
Partner with the CFO to assist with the development of the budget and monthly reforecast.
Work with external financial audit and tax teams.
Establish internal and financial controls.
Work with the CFO on any ad hoc tasks and analyses.
Manage cash flow reporting.
Team up with accounting leadership to drive teamwork and positive culture in the accounting division.
Understanding of multi-state sales and use tax.
Qualifications:
Bachelor’s degree in accounting.
Understanding of US GAAP, revenue recognition, WIP, and general ledger concepts.
Experience leading month-end close through financial statement preparation.
Experience in multi-entity, multi-state environment.
8-10 years of progressive accounting experience.
At least 3+ years managing an accounting team.
Proven experience with process automation and/or operational improvements
Own 1099 compliance.
Proficient in Microsoft Excel.
